‘Bluey’ Special ‘The Sign’ Draws 10.4 Million Views on Disney+

Disney+ will hardly be feeling blue after seeing the viewership for the “Bluey” special episode “The Sign.”

According to the Mouse House, the special has drawn 10.4 million views globally in its first seven days of availability. It first became available on Disney+ on April 14, with a view defined as total stream time divided by runtime. It is also the most-viewed Disney Junior episode premiere and biggest “Bluey” episode premiere ever on Disney+.

“Bluey” has proven to be a smash hit on streaming, with the show ranking as the second most-streamed show of 2023 according to the Nielsen rankings, with 43.9 billion minutes viewed.
